N-[3-(3-吲哚基)丙基]-3-硝基苯甲酰胺

N-[3-(1H-indol-3-yl)propyl]-3-nitrobenzamide

Also Known As: N-(3-(3-Indolyl)propyl)-m-nitrobenzamide, N-[3-(1H-indol-3-yl)propyl]-3-nitrobenzamide, BENZAMIDE, N-(3-(3-INDOLYL)PROPYL)-m-NITRO-, 5-22-10-00153 (Beilstein Handbook Reference), N-[3-(1H-Indol-3-yl)propyl]-m-nitrobenzamide

CAS: 72612-07-8
Molecular Formula C18H17N3O3
Molecular Weight 323.13 g/mol
LogP 3.6
Topological Polar Surface Area 90.7 Ų
Hydrogen Bond Donors 2
Hydrogen Bond Acceptors 3
Rotatable Bonds 5
Exact Mass 323.12698
Heavy Atoms 24
Complexity 451.0

Chemical Identifiers

CAS Number 72612-07-8
SMILES C1=CC=C2C(=C1)C(=CN2)CCCNC(=O)C3=CC(=CC=C3)[N+](=O)[O-]
InChIKey FEYHCEGFFWNPBQ-UHFFFAOYSA-N

Property Insights of N-[3-(3-吲哚基)丙基]-3-硝基苯甲酰胺

The XLogP value of 3.6 indicates that N-[3-(3-吲哚基)丙基]-3-硝基苯甲酰胺 is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 90.7 Ų falls within the moderate polarity range, balancing permeability and solubility for N-[3-(3-吲哚基)丙基]-3-硝基苯甲酰胺. Following Lipinski's Rule of Five, N-[3-(3-吲哚基)丙基]-3-硝基苯甲酰胺 has 2 hydrogen bond donor(s) and 3 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
